AO55 CVP is a 2005 Nissan Pathfinder in Grey with a 2,488cc diesel engine. This vehicle has been through 20 MOT tests with a personal pass rate of 70%.
Across all 2005 Nissan Pathfinder models, the average MOT pass rate is 70.7% with a typical mileage of 98,510 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Nissan Pathfinder f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 4,402 recorded failures. If you're considering buying AO55 CVP, it's worth having these areas checked by a mechanic before committing.
The Nissan Pathfinder typically stays on UK roads for around 21 years. At 21 years old, this Nissan Pathfinder is approaching the upper end of the typical lifespan for this model.
